American Express's most recent trend suggests a bullish bias. One trading opportunity on American Express is a Bull Put Spread using a strike $117.00 short put and a strike $112.00 long put offers a potential 28.53% return on risk over the next 20 calendar days. Maximum profit would be generated if the Bull Put Spread were to expire worthless, which would occur if the stock were above $117.00 by expiration. The full premium credit of $1.11 would be kept by the premium seller. The risk of $3.89 would be incurred if the stock dropped below the $112.00 long put strike price.
The 5-day moving average is moving up which suggests that the short-term momentum for American Express is bullish and the probability of a rise in share price is higher if the stock starts trending.
The 20-day moving average is moving up which suggests that the medium-term momentum for American Express is bullish.
The RSI indicator is at 44.96 level which suggests that the stock is neither overbought nor oversold at this time.

The Tampa-St. Petersburg area is among the top metropolitan areas for women-owned businesses, according to a recent study. The report, which was conducted by American Express (NYSE: AXP), used data from the Census Bureau to rank the nation's top 50 metropolitan areas based on their growth of women-owned businesses, the number of jobs they created and the firms’ revenue growth between 2014 and 2019. Tampa Bay had the 12th highest growth of women-owned businesses and 25th best growth for new jobs. Overall, the bay area had the fourth best job growth and third best new job creation among Florida’s metro areas. Over the last five years, Miami had the fourth best business growth overall and the best growth in Florida.
